March 23 is celebrated as World Meteorological Day across the world. The aim of which is to spread awareness and awareness among the people about the changes taking place in it along with meteorology. Every year a theme is set for it on which the whole year is also done.

When it started: The World Meteorological Organization was established in the year 1950 with the aim of understanding the mood of the weather and its positive-negative effects. It is headquartered in Geneva, Switzerland. The World Metrological Organization has a total of 191 member countries and territories. This organization is used to estimate natural disasters such as floods, droughts and earthquakes. So that the damage caused by it can be avoided in time.

How this day is celebrated: As already said, 191 countries around the world are members of the World Metrological Organization. On this day, many types of events are also organized all over the world. An attempt is also made to make people aware of things that change the mood of the weather and lead to natural disasters. On the day of World Meteorological Day, many types of debates, art competitions are also organized in schools, colleges, offices. From children to scientists, together they put their ideas in front of each other.
